Is Royal Asia Shrimp Miso Ramen With Spring Onions Soy Free?

No. This product is not soy free as it lists 3 ingredients that contain soy.

Why it's not soy free

  • soy sauce powder
  • soy sauce
  • soy

Ingredients

WATER, WHEAT FLOUR, SHRIMP, ACETYLATED STARCH, SOY, HYDROXYPROPYL STARCH, MIRIN, SALT, WHEAT GLUTEN, SPRING ONION, RICE, SODIUM CARBONATE, SUGAR, COCONUT MILK, CALCIUM OXIDE, SOY SAUCE POWDER (SOY, WHEAT, SALT, MALTODEXTRIN), YEAST EXTRACT, SKIPJACK TUNA EXTRACT POWDER, DEXTROSE MONOHYDRATE, SOY SAUCE (SOY, WHEAT, SALT, WATER), KELP POWDER, SILICON DIOXIDE, MUSHROOM POWDER, NATURAL COLOR (VITAMIN B2), DISTILLED VINEGAR. CONTAINS CRUSTACEAN SHELLFISH (SHRIMP), SOY, WHEAT, FISH (SKIPJACK TUNA).
